还剩28页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
数控加工编程编制本课程旨在帮助学生掌握数控加工的基本知识和编程技能我们将学习数控机床的结构和工作原理、编程语言和编码方法,并通过实际案例练习提高编程能力课程简介课程目标课程内容教学方式适用对象通过本课程的学习,学生将掌包括数控加工的基本概念、数采用理论讲解、操作演示、实本课程适合机械制造、数控技握数控加工编程的基本原理和控机床结构与特点、数控程序践训练相结合的方式,强化学术、机电一体化等专业的学生编程方法,为实际生产中的数编写、加工参数设置等内容,生的实践能力和应用水平学习,为将来从事数控加工工控加工任务做好准备让学生全面掌握数控加工编程作奠定基础的核心知识数控加工的基本概念数控技术原理数控加工特点数控技术利用数字信号控制机床数控加工具有自动化程度高、生运动,实现高精度和灵活性的加工产效率高、加工精度高、加工灵这种基于数字编程的控制方式活性强等优点,广泛应用于航空、大大提高了生产效率和产品质量汽车、机械等行业数控编程工艺数控编程通过G代码和M代码指令,来控制机床的运动路径、主轴转速、进给速度等,实现复杂零件的高效加工数控加工的工作流程编程设计1根据产品要求进行数控编程,设计加工路径和参数数控加工2将编程内容输入到数控机床,完成实际的加工过程检验测量3对加工件进行尺寸和质量检查,确保符合要求数控加工的基本知识机床控制系统加工编程12数控机床采用电子计算机对加工过程进行自动控制,实现高精使用数控编程语言编写加工程序,控制刀具沿着预先设定的路度、高效率的加工径执行切削加工工艺自动化生产34合理选择切削参数、刀具及夹具,并制定出最优的加工工艺流数控机床可配合自动上下料、零件交换等设备,实现自动化持程续生产数控机床的结构与特点数控机床是现代制造业中广泛应用的一种高度自动化的加工设备它由机床本体、数控系统、驱动系统、测量系统等部件组成,具有高精度、高效率、可编程等特点数控机床可快速完成复杂零件的加工,大幅提高生产效率和产品质量与传统机床相比,数控机床具有结构更紧凑、自动化程度更高、加工精度更好等优势它能实现智能化操作,满足现代制造业日益复杂的生产需求,在航空航天、汽车制造等行业广泛应用数控机床的主要部件主轴进给轴主轴是数控机床的核心部件之一,用进给轴用于控制刀具相对工件的移动于驱动夹持工件或刀具的转动,确保加工精度并保证切削质量刀库数控装置刀库自动存储和更换不同类型的刀具,数控装置是数控机床的大脑,用于接提高生产效率和加工精度收和执行加工程序指令数控机床的坐标系数控机床的坐标系是表示工件和刀具位置的三维参考系通常采用右手直角坐标系,X轴水平向右,Y轴垂直向上,Z轴垂直向外机床的运动和程序编写均以这个坐标系为基准理解坐标系的定义和使用非常重要,可以帮助操准确定位和控制加工过程数控程序的基本格式程序结构程序编号程序页眉数控程序由程序头、主程序和子程序三大部每个数控程序都有一个唯一的编号,用于标页眉用于显示当前程序的基本信息,如程序分组成程序头用于设置加工参数,主程序识和管理程序编号通常由字母和数字组成名称、零件名称、编程日期等良好的程序包含整个加工过程的G代码和M代码命令,子,如PROG01或MILLING-A1页眉有助于快速识别和管理程序程序用于复用重复的编程模块代码的基本语法G代码的结构代码的常见指令代码的数值格式G GGG代码由命令码(G)、进给码(F)、主轴•G00/G01:快速移动/线性插补G代码的数值通常采用四位小数的格式,以毫码(S)以及坐标值等部分组成每行代码米或度为单位例如G01X
100.0123Y-•G02/G03:顺时针/逆时针圆弧插补都有独立的地址码和数值
20.5678•G04:停留指令•G17/G18/G19:选择加工平面代码的基本应用M程序开始指令主轴控制切削液控制刀具更换M02或M30用于标识程序开始M03/M04/M05用于控制主轴M07/M08/M09用于启动、停M06用于自动刀具更换或手动或结束正反转和停止止和关闭切削液更换刀具数控程序的编写步骤确定加工要求
1.1根据图纸和工艺文件明确零件的形状、尺寸和加工工艺选择合适的数控机床
2.2结合零件特性和加工工艺选择适当的数控机床编写程序代码
3.3根据零件几何和加工工艺编写出完整的数控程序程序调试
4.4利用模拟系统仔细调试程序,确保无误后再投入生产编写数控程序是高效数控加工的关键步骤从确定加工要求,到选择合适机床,再到编写程序代码并进行调试,每个环节都需要精心准备,以确保生产出高质量的零件直线段的编程确定起点1根据工件图纸明确直线段的起始位置,设置合适的坐标值编写直线段程序2使用G00或G01指令编写快移或加工直线段的程序代码设置进给速度3根据工艺要求合理设置直线段的进给速度测试验证4仔细检查程序是否有误,并在模拟环境下测试运行编程直线段是数控加工中最基础的操作之一正确编写直线段程序是保证后续加工质量的关键编程时需要确定起点位置、合理设置进给速度、并进行仔细测试验证圆弧段的编程确定圆弧起始点通过定义刀具当前位置或预先计算,确定圆弧段的起始点坐标设定圆弧参数输入圆弧半径、圆弧角度或终点坐标等参数,定义圆弧段的几何形状选择合适的码G根据圆弧旋转方向和是否需要切线连接,选择G02/G03等合适的G代码编写程序将圆弧参数组合成完整的CNC程序代码,确保控制器能正确识别并执行加工功能代码的使用代码代码应用技巧G M数控程序中常用的加工功能代M代码用于控制机床的辅助功合理搭配G代码和M代码,可大码包括G00快速移动、G01直能,如启动主轴旋转、进行工幅提升数控加工的灵活性和效线插补、G02/G03圆弧插补等件夹持、实现程序流程控制等率需根据工艺要求选择恰当它们控制刀具沿特定轨迹进配合G代码可实现复杂的加的功能代码行加工工动作循环功能代码的使用一次循环多次循环使用G98/G99指令可以执行一次利用G70-G79指令可以实现重复循环加工,如孔加工等这种循执行一段程序的多次循环加工,环可以简化编程、提高加工效率通常用于相似零件的批量生产固定循环G80-G89指令提供了常见孔加工的固定循环功能,如钻孔、镗孔、攻丝等,可以大幅简化编程几何补偿的设置建立坐标系输入公差参数12在数控加工中需要建立合适的根据工艺要求,在数控程序中输工件坐标系和机床坐标系,确保入对应的公差数值,确保尺寸精加工位置的准确性度补偿计算与设置试切验证34利用数控系统的几何补偿功能,加工前进行样件切削,实测尺寸自动计算并设置补偿值,消除机并调整补偿参数,确保最终产品床和工件等因素引起的误差符合要求刀具补偿的设置刀具长度补偿刀具半径补偿补偿调整方法补偿设置注意事项在数控加工过程中,需要正确为了补偿刀具半径的误差,需通过反复测试和调整刀具补偿在设置刀具补偿时,需要充分设置刀具长度补偿,以确保刀要在程序中设置正确的刀具半参数,可以达到理想的加工效考虑加工材料、刀具型号、切具切削深度的精确性这包括径补偿这可以确保加工轮廓果这需要仔细观察加工件的削参数等因素,确保补偿值与测量刀具的实际长度并在程序的精度,避免因刀具半径不同尺寸和形状,并适时进行补偿实际加工情况相匹配中输入正确的补偿值而造成的偏差修正切削参数的选择切削速度进给速度根据被加工材料的硬度、刀具材结合切削深度、切削量等因素合质等因素合理选择切削速度,平衡理设置进给速度,确保加工质量的加工效率和刀具使用寿命同时提高生产效率切削深度冷却润滑根据工件尺寸、刀具强度等因素选用适当的冷却润滑方式,既能有合理控制切削深度,避免过大切削效降低切削温度,又不影响加工质导致刀具破损或工件变形量加工工艺的制定制定加工工艺流程选择合适的工艺装备确定最佳加工参数编制完整的加工工艺方案根据产品要求和设备条件,制定根据零件特性、加工精度要求通过试切测试,确定切深、进给合理的加工工艺流程,包括切削合理选择数控机床、夹具、量、转速等最佳加工参数,确保加将加工流程、工艺装备、工艺参数、工艺路线、刀具选择等具等工艺装备工质量和效率参数等全面整合,形成完整的加工工艺文件程序调试的方法检查程序1仔细检查程序中的语法和逻辑是否正确测试程序2采用手动输入指令的方式逐步运行程序分析结果3根据加工结果分析程序的问题所在修改程序4根据分析结果对程序进行必要的修改熟练掌握数控程序调试的方法对保证加工质量和提高生产效率至关重要包括仔细检查程序、手动逐步测试、分析加工结果、针对性修改程序等步骤通过反复调试与优化,最终确保程序在实际加工中能够准确无误地执行样件加工的操作样件加工是数控编程的关键步骤,需要严格按照编写好的程序进行操作首先要对机床进行调试校准,确保各项参数准确无误然后仔细检查刀具状态,合理设置切削参数和加工路径在实际加工过程中,要密切观察加工情况,及时进行调整和优化加工完成后,需要对样件进行质检,确保产品满足要求同时要认真总结经验教训,为下一步的实际生产做好准备程序保存与管理程序存儲程序備份程序版本控制數控程序可以保存在機床控制系統、外部存定期備份數控程序文件是必要的,以防止意對於複雜的數控加工任務,建議採用版本控儲設備或專業軟件中合理組織程序文件非外丟失或損壞可以采用云存儲、外部硬盤制系統管理程序的修改歷史,確保操作的可常重要,以確保方便快捷的管理和查找等多種備份方式靠性和可追溯性常见问题排查与解决在数控加工编程过程中,可能会遇到各种各样的问题常见的问题包括程序语法错误、刀具补偿设置错误、加工参数不当等通过仔细检查程序代码、确认机床参数设置、监控加工过程,可以有效地排查并解决这些问题同时还要注意日常维护保养,保证机床及工具的良好状态,以确保加工质量一旦发现异常情况,应及时采取相应的解决措施,避免造成更大的损失数控加工编程常见应用机械制造模具制造12数控加工在汽车、航空航天、数控加工可制造精密复杂的模家电等行业广泛应用,生产各种具,广泛用于塑料、金属等行业复杂零部件的成型模具工艺装备医疗器械34数控加工可生产各种专用夹具数控加工在制造假肢、义齿等、工装等工艺装备,提高生产效医疗器械上发挥重要作用,确保率和质量高精度数控加工编程前沿动态自动化技术大数据应用数控加工正朝着更高度自动化发展,数据采集和分析技术的应用,可以优通过机器视觉、协作机器人等技术提化生产计划、改善设备维护、提升产高生产效率品质量人工智能工业物联网基于机器学习的智能制造系统,可以通过物联网技术实现设备互联互通,实现自主诊断、优化调整、故障预测可提升生产过程的可视性和可控性等功能职业发展与培训广阔的职业前景专业培训机会持续学习与提升行业认证与资格数控加工编程是制造业中的一行业内有许多专业培训机构提数控加工编程领域技术日新月获得相关专业认证,如数控编项关键技能,随着技术的发展,供系统的数控加工编程课程,异,从业人员需要保持持续学程师等资格证书,可以提升个相关岗位需求不断增加从数从基础知识到实操技能一应俱习的心态,不断更新知识和技人在行业内的竞争力和发展前控编程员到数控工程师,都有全学员可以获得理论知识和能,以应对行业发展的变化景广阔的职业发展空间实践经验的全面提升实操案例演示为了帮助学习者更好地理解数控加工编程的实际应用,本课程将展示几个典型的加工案例,从编程到实际操作全过程进行详细讲解通过实践演示,学习者可以深入了解数控加工编程的各个步骤,包括程序编写、工艺参数设置、刀具补偿、加工及调试等,并掌握相关技能测试与评价理论考核实操考核12通过理论测试了解学生对数控让学生进行实际零件加工,考察加工编程的掌握程度其操作技能综合评价反馈改进34结合理论和实操成绩,全面评价根据考核结果,及时反馈并优化学生的学习效果教学内容和方法总结与展望在本次数控加工编程课程中,我们系统地学习了数控加工的基本概念、工作流程、机床结构和特点、程序编写等知识通过实践演示和案例分析,掌握了数控加工编程的核心技能。
个人认证
优秀文档
获得点赞 0